Dark Lies
A pulse-pounding crime thriller (Detective Logan Cooper Series Book 1)
Elliot York

In the gritty underbelly of crime fiction, Elliot York's Dark Lies stands as a titanic force, a relentless barrage of suspense that grips you from the first page. The journey of Detective Logan Cooper unfurls in a whirlwind of deceit, treachery, and an unforgiving quest for truth that will leave readers breathless and craving more. This isn't just a book; it's a high-octane ride into moral ambiguity that pulls back the curtain on the darker sides of human nature-an exploration that resonates far beyond the pages.
York expertly weaves a narrative that feels both refreshingly original and hauntingly familiar, inviting you deeper into a labyrinth where nothing is as it seems. As Logan Cooper embarks on a harrowing investigation filled with intricate twists and chilling revelations, you are thrust into a world where age-old secrets threaten to unravel the very fabric of society. Each twist is sharper than the last, keeping you on the edge as the plot escalates with relentless intensity.
But Dark Lies is not merely a stack of thrills waiting to unfold; it's a visceral examination of the human condition. Through Cooper's eyes, we witness not just a detective's struggle against crime, but a soulful grappling with personal demons. The weight of his choices is palpable, resonating with anyone who has faced their own moral crossroads. It forces you to empathize with a character who, despite his flaws, embodies the eternal fight for justice. You can almost feel the tension in the air as he navigates the murky waters of ethical dilemmas that haunt him at every turn.
York's prose is a beacon-sharp, evocative, and resonant. He paints scenes with such clarity that you almost smell the damp streets and hear the echo of footsteps in the night. This vivid imagery cultivates an immersive experience, making the stakes feel incredibly real. As you tear through the chapters, each page seems to burn, urging you to uncover the next secret lurking in the shadows. 📖
What truly elevates this narrative is the interplay of reality and fiction, where familiar societal issues are dissected under the microscope of crime and consequence. Readers have commented on this aspect, praising York for constructing a plot that feels relevant amidst current events, making us question our perceptions of truth and trust. Critics have noted how Dark Lies touches on themes of betrayal and loyalty, resonating with those perhaps disillusioned by the state of the world today.
However, not every voice sings praises; a few readers criticized the pace, claiming that certain sections felt drawn out. Yet, it's precisely these moments of reflection that enrich the story, allowing you to digest the moral weight of Cooper's journey. The revelation is that York challenges you to consider the implications of each character's choices, pushing you past mere entertainment and into the realm of introspection.
As you reach the unsettling conclusion, it's evident that Dark Lies is more than a thrilling mystery; it's a stark reminder of the complexities within each of us. The tale reverberates with the echoes of lives interconnected by the threads of deception, inviting you to reflect on your own truths.
You may find yourself haunted by the story long after the final page is turned, grappling with questions of ethics and the unsettling nature of trust. Elliot York has not only delivered a compelling entry into detective fiction but has laid bare the human experience in all its flawed glory.
